Output 93ea6b7e122f226ddac3290f8187b568a3c66ab509f0f5dc01018cd899f16ef5:4

value
748364
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 20da16fa0d910debd66e3f998693200608b12fdc OP_EQUALVERIFY OP_CHECKSIG
address
13zhtHFp1KgMESVrgsfkskCx9nZV4cgjvw
transaction
93ea6b7e122f226ddac3290f8187b568a3c66ab509f0f5dc01018cd899f16ef5
spent
true